Southampton boss Nigel Adkins has surprisingly been backed by "a flood of money" to become ChampionshipBlackpool's new manager.
Adkins current team Southampton reside rock bottom of the Premier League with just four points from their opening 10 games.
Their Chris Spicer, of Sky Bet, said he would be surprised if Adkins were to move north.
"I think it's classic case of a manager being on the brink of leaving one job and punters think he's going to another," he said.
"I'd have thought it would take at least a week for Adkins to sort out leaving Southampton and the Blackpool job will also be relatively low-paid."
